Does anybody know why capitalism a free-market economy????
oee [108]
Well, capitalism is not always a free-market economy.

A typical capitalism is a free-market economy, which means that the market itself (buyer and sellers) can decide the prizes and terms of services.

In capitalism, the capital is privately, and not state owned. But capitalism can also come in other forms: of social democracy with partially free market, and with other forms which include corporations having controls over the market.
